Dave Bautista ruined some fan-casting dreams today as he told Insider that he would not be the DC Universe’s Bane. While Bautista would undoubtedly kill it in the role, James Gunn is looking to start younger with his new version of the DCU. Bautista said “You need to start to plan for the next 15 years, and I just don’t think you can do that with me,” adding “I have to say that I appreciate that because I don’t want to play a character that I can’t bring justice to it.”

Dave Bautista, who is now 54, may have trouble staying in physical shape for a demanding role like Bane in the long-term plans for the DC Universe. Bane is a huge, physically imposing character and the demands to get in shape to realistically portray the character would be exceedingly difficult even for actors in their physical prime. It does make sense that Bautista is ok with giving up the role, as disappointing as it might be for fans.

While we might not be seeing Dave Bautista in a DC film in the near future, there are plenty of other projects we can look forward to. Most recently, he appeared in the Rian Johnson-directed Glass Onion: A Knives Out Mystery, which is currently available to stream on Netflix. You can also look forward to seeing him in the latest film from M. Night Shyamalan titled Knock at the Cabin, which releases on February 3.

Dave Bautista also has several huge blockbusters on the horizon. He’ll be reprising his role as Beast Rabban in Denis Villeneuve’s Dune: Part Two, which will adapt the second half of Frank Herbert’s seminal sci-fi novel. That film will hit theaters on November 3, 2023.

Before then, you can see Dave Bautista in a non-DC comic-book film as he returns as Drax in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 3. The film will also be the final MCU bow for director and writer James Gunn. You can catch that film in theaters on May 5.
